Covering part of Hennepin County, Minnesota, ZIP Code 55305 has about 21,274 residents. The median household income of $106,480 is above the Hennepin County median ($96,339).
Between 2019 and 2023, ZIP Code 55305's population held roughly steady from 21,406 to 21,274, while its median gross rent rose 26.5% from $1,402 to $1,774.
The median resident is 39.8 years old. The largest age group is 25 to 34, 18.7% of residents.

| Year | Population | Median household income | Median home value | Median gross rent |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2019 | 21,406 | $82,710 | $332,400 | $1,402 |
| 2020 | 21,337 | $87,461 | $347,400 | $1,462 |
| 2021 | 21,687 | $95,701 | $358,800 | $1,550 |
| 2022 | 21,256 | $104,380 | $417,400 | $1,723 |
| 2023 | 21,274 | $106,480 | $442,200 | $1,774 |
Each year is a US Census Bureau ACS 5-year estimate ending that year.
